Listen to article The Capital Development Authority (CDA) and the Metropolitan Corporation Islamabad (MCI) have successfully extinguished the fire that broke out near Faisal Mosque in the Margalla Hills on Monday afternoon. CDA Chairman Muhammad Ali Randhawa oversaw the firefighting efforts, as confirmed by his spokesperson. A coordinated response was carried out by officers from the Islamabad administration, CDA’s Environment Wing, and various other departments. Over 64 firefighters participated in the operation, with fire brigade vehicles specially deployed to manage the blaze. Bad weather also impacts islands in the Cyclades chain in the central Aegean Sea popular with tourists.Ferocious storms have battered islands in Greece for a second day, hurling cars into the sea and flooding homes and businesses with water and mud with Crete experiencing the heaviest rainfall and flooding. Authorities on the islands of Paros and Mykonos in the Aegean Sea worked to clear overturned cars and debris after hailstorms and torrential downpours on Tuesday. German police officer among those held in raids against the ‘Ndrangheta over sales of expensive food and equipment.German and Italian authorities have arrested dozens of suspects, including a policeman, in raids against the ‘Ndrangheta criminal organisation over fraud involving the sale of expensive food and pizza-making equipment. The ‘Ndrangheta is considered Italy’s wealthiest and most powerful Mafia and is also heavily involved in drug trafficking, controlling the bulk of cocaine flowing into Europe. Listen to article Pakistan has postponed a deadline for the deportation of hundreds of thousands of Afghans due to the Eidul Fitr holidays marking the end of Ramadan, a government official confirmed on Tuesday. The government had initially set a deadline for March 31 for Afghans holding specific documentation to leave the country, intensifying efforts to repatriate Afghan nationals. However, the government has now extended the deadline until the beginning of next week due to the holiday period, according to an official.
